Patent number: 11306421Abstract: An apparatus for making spunbonded nonwovens has a spinneret for emitting continuous thermoplastic filaments in a filament-travel direction, a cooling chamber downstream in the direction from the spinneret for cooling the spun filaments with cooling air, two manifolds on opposite sides of the cooling chamber opening transversely of the direction into the cooling chamber, and a respective conduit having a conduit cross-sectional area and connected to each manifold for feeding cooling air thereto. The conduit cross-sectional area increases toward the manifold to a manifold cross-sectional area, and manifold cross-sectional area is at least twice as large as the conduit cross-sectional area. At least one flow straightener is provided upstream from the cooling chamber in each manifold for orienting air flow in an air-flow direction, and at least one perforated planar homogenizing element is provided in each manifold for homogenizing the cooling air flow.Type: GrantFiled: May 27, 2019Date of Patent: April 19, 2022Assignee: REIFENHAEUSER GMBH & CO KG MASCHINENFABRIKInventors: Michael Nitschke, Martin Neuenhofer, Hans-Georg Geus, Detlef Frey

Patent number: 11066766Abstract: An apparatus for making spunbonded nonwoven from continuous thermoplastic filaments has a spinneret for downwardly emitting the continuous filaments in a filament direction, a cooling chamber directly beneath the spinneret for receiving the filaments from the spinneret and cooling the spun filaments with cooling air and having relative to a longitudinally extending machine direction a pair of longitudinal sides extending parallel to the machine direction and a pair of transverse sides extending substantially perpendicular to the machine direction between the longitudinal sides. Respective air-supply manifolds on the transverse sides feed cooling air therefrom into the cooling chamber. The cooling air is extracted from the cooling chamber at the longitudinal sides. A stretcher directly beneath the cooling chamber receives and elongates the cooled filaments, and a device deposits the stretched filaments as a band and conveys the band off in the machine direction.Type: GrantFiled: May 23, 2019Date of Patent: July 20, 2021Assignee: REIFENHAEUSER GMBH & CO. Patent number: 10995436Abstract: The invention relates to a method for producing a nonwoven fabric from fibres, wherein the fibres are spun by means of at least one spinneret, are cooled and then deposited on a collection device to form a nonwoven web. The nonwoven web undergoes hot fluid bonding during at least two consecutive bonding steps. In a first bonding step, the surface of the nonwoven web is subjected to a hot fluid and, in a second bonding step, the surface of the nonwoven web is also subsequently subjected to a hot fluid and, in addition and at the same time, surface pressure is exerted on the nonwoven web.Type: GrantFiled: February 23, 2018Date of Patent: May 4, 2021Assignees: REIFENHAEUSER GMBH & CO. Patent number: 10894384Abstract: A laminate is made by first non-crimping or low-crimping continuous filaments to form a first spunbond layer and preconsolidating the first spunbond layer with a heated or calendering roller. Then continuous filaments with a greater crimp than the continuous filaments of the first spunbond layer are deposited as a second spunbond layer over the first spunbond layer to create a two-layer structure. Finally, the two-layer structure of the first and second spunbond layers is consolidated such that a total thickness of the laminate is 0.15 to 3 mm, preferably 0.2 mm to 2.5 mm and especially 0.2 mm to 2 mm.Type: GrantFiled: February 2, 2016Date of Patent: January 19, 2021Assignees: REIFENHAEUSER GMBH & CO. Patent number: 10618212Abstract: A coextrusion apparatus, a single-layer extrusion apparatus, a retrofit kit, as well as to a method for measuring a layer thickness, for producing a plastic film, and for retrofitting an extrusion apparatus. From the state of the art, it is known to add a detection agent in the form of a fluorescent granulate into the starting material at the extruder, in order to be able to measure the layer thickness of the layer in the film composite produced from this starting material. However, it is proposed to feed in a detection agent only beyond the extruder. This leads to a clearly shorter running time of the detection agent through the system and thereby to clearly faster measurability of changes in the production parameters.Type: GrantFiled: September 29, 2015Date of Patent: April 14, 2020Assignee: REIFENHAEUSER GMBH & CO. Patent number: 10507143Abstract: Excretion by a diaper wearer in a diaper is predicted by providing in or on the diaper on the wearer an excretion detector capable of detecting excretion by the diaper wearer and a motion sensor capable of detecting movements of the diaper wearer. The sensor continuously detects and at least temporarily records movements of the diaper wearer, and these detected movements are analyzed to determine movement patterns. Then, on detection of excretion by the detector, a movement pattern immediately preceding the detection of excretion is stored or flagged as a critical movement pattern. Thereafter each time movements matching the critical movement pattern are detected, a signal is sent to a user.Type: GrantFiled: April 14, 2017Date of Patent: December 17, 2019Assignee: REIFENHAEUSER GMBH & CO. Patent number: 10428443Abstract: The invention relates to a device for producing a spun-bonded web from filaments, comprising spinnerets, a cooling chamber into which process air can be introduced in order to cool the filaments, a monomer suction device arranged between the spinnerets and the cooling chamber, a stretching unit, and a placing device for placing the filaments so as to form the spun-bonded web. The cooling chamber is divided into two cooling chamber portions. Process air can be suctioned out of a first upper cooling chamber portion to the monomer suction device with a volumetric flow rate Vm, and process air exits the first upper cooling chamber portion into a second lower cooling chamber portion with a volumetric flow rate V1. The volumetric flow rate ratio VM/V1 is 0.1 to 0.3.Type: GrantFiled: November 25, 2013Date of Patent: October 1, 2019Assignee: REIFENHAEUSER GMBH & CO. Patent number: 10385491Abstract: An apparatus for making a spunbond nonwoven from monofilaments of thermoplastic synthetics has a spinneret for spinning and emitting the filaments in a travel direction, a cooler downstream of the spinneret for cooling the spun filaments, and a stretcher downstream of the cooler for stretching the filaments. An intermediate passage extending in the travel direction between the cooler and the stretcher has upstream and downstream converging passage sections. The upstream passage section in the travel direction of the filaments having a shorter length than the downstream passage section in the travel direction of the filaments. A ratio BE/BA of an inlet width BE to an outlet width BA of the upstream passage section is 1.5 to 5.5. A ratio of an inlet width bE, to an outlet width bA, of the downstream passage section is 1 to 4.Type: GrantFiled: January 25, 2017Date of Patent: August 20, 2019Assignee: REIFENHAEUSER GMBH & CO. Patent number: 10137629Abstract: In blown film installations, it is known to provide longitudinal stretching of the produced double layer film strip downstream of the draw-off, more precisely downstream of the reversing unit and upstream of the winder. It is also known to stretch the down-drawn film, wherein the film must then be preheated owing to the long cooling path from the draw-off. According to a first feature, the present invention specifies warming the film above the draw-off and then treating it mechanically. The film can thereby be brought with only little energy from a first level of warmth to a temperature level at which it can easily be worked. According to a second feature, the invention specifies providing a tractive force breakdown brake.Type: GrantFiled: August 7, 2013Date of Patent: November 27, 2018Assignee: Reifenhaeuser GmbH & Co. Patent number: 9982367Abstract: A method of making a spun-bond nonwoven fabric of thermoplastic filaments has the steps of first spinning the thermoplastic filaments, then cooling the spun filaments, and then conducting the cooled and spun filaments in a travel direction through a stretcher with primary air such that the primary air exits a downstream end of the stretcher with the filaments at a predetermined primary air volume/flow VP. The filaments and substantially all of the primary air are passed together as a flow from the downstream end of the stretcher into a diffuser. Secondary air is introduced into the flow at a secondary air volume/flow VS such that a ratio VP/VS of the primary rate VP to the secondary rate is equal to at least 4.5 and the primary and secondary air flow with the filaments in the travel direction through the diffuser.Type: GrantFiled: April 26, 2016Date of Patent: May 29, 2018Assignee: REIFENHAEUSER GMBH & CO.
